Ingredients:

(Makes about 4-5 servings)

2 large rotisserie chicken breasts (skin removed)

2-3 stalks of celery

1 small shallot, peeled

¼ teaspoon black pepper

Salt (to taste)

¼ teaspoon onion powder

2.5 teaspoons rice wine vinegar

½ cup Mayo

Directions:

1. Cut the rotisserie chicken breast into cubes. Place the pieces in the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with a whisk attachment and blend on low speed until the chicken breaks up into fine shreds.

2. Using a box grater with medium holes, grate the celery and shallot, into fine pieces (discard the strings of the celery that may be left behind after grating it).

3. On low speed or by hand stir the celery and shallot into the chicken shreds and then sprinkle in the pepper, onion powder and salt (to taste).

4. Drizzle in the rice wine vinegar and then add the mayo and stir everything together until combined.
